Sat 517898986582762

decimal
103579.3986582762
degree
0°103579′763″3986582762‴
percentile
24.661856531069102%
name
kejcixsucix
cycle
0
epoch
0
period
51
block
103579
offset
3986582762
timestamp
rarity
common